The Recycling Process: Transforming Waste into Resources
Recycling brass ball valves involves several key steps. First, discarded valves are collected and sorted to separate brass from other materials. The brass components are then cleaned and processed to remove impurities, such as coatings or contaminants. Next, the cleaned brass is melted down and cast into new forms, ready to be used in manufacturing. This process consumes significantly less energy than producing brass from virgin materials, making it a more sustainable alternative. Additionally, recycling brass reduces the demand for mining, which has severe environmental and social impacts, including habitat destruction and water pollution.

Challenges and Strategies for Implementing Urban Mining
While the concept of urban mining is promising, its implementation faces several challenges. One major issue is the lack of efficient collection systems for discarded brass ball valves, which are often scattered across various industries and locations. To address this, governments and industry stakeholders can establish take-back programs or incentivize the return of used valves. Another challenge is the need for advanced recycling technologies to ensure high-quality brass recovery. Investing in research and development can improve recycling efficiency and reduce costs. Collaboration among manufacturers, recyclers, policymakers, and consumers is essential to create a robust circular economy framework.
